TELEGRAPHIC SHIPPING.
[by cable.] Melbourne, Tuesday. Arrived— Rotomahana, Captain Underwood. She had a splendid passage. (by special wire.) Auckland, Tuesday. Arrived — Australia. She left San Francisco on the Ist of September with the colonial mail. She brings 4577 bags of barley and a general; cargo for New Zealand. Among the passengers are Madame Camilla Norso, the famous violinist, and a company en route for Sydney. . The following are the New Zealand passengers -.—Messrs Readwille, JfTLeod, Burke, Peath, Walton, Hyms, Wilson, wife and child, H. Cosen ; Meadames Smith and Sunderland, and 20 in the steerage.
